WebDec 10, 2024 · In 2015, the FDA approved a genetically modified salmon created by a company called AquaBounty, as fit for human consumption. AquAdvantage, as the GMO salmon is called, contains a splice of genes, including the Pacific chinook salmon and a bottom-dweller fish known as an eelpout.The result, reportedly, is a salmon that grows … WebGet a taste of homegrown freshness with True North Atlantic salmon fillets. Web109 mg. Farm caught salmon has a much higher fat count than wild-caught salmon. The difference is actually pretty stark, especially the saturated fat. Farm-raised salmon can have up to 46% more calories from fat than a wild-caught salmon. Farm raised can have three times the number of saturated fats.
